To execute this move, you must use [[PK Fire]] within one frame of your double jump. The timing takes a bit of | To execute this move, you must use [[PK Fire]] within one frame of your double jump. The timing takes a bit of practice, but you basically hit the jump right before you use PK Fire and Lucas will shoot up quite a long distance. This can be combined with Lucas' other techniques such as [[B-Sticking]] and [[Magnet Pull]] for an impressive recovery. To make the execution of this technique easier, it is advised to set the L-button (or R-button if you roll with the L-button) to jump, so you do not have to claw the L and B buttons at the same time. | ||

There is also an interesting effect when Ness' [[PK Fire]] interacts with his second jump. When PK Fire is executed at the same time as his second jump, he shoots backwards and up a bit while using his PK Fire. While this has no use in recovery, it makes a great approach due to the way he shoots his PK Fire. It also extends PK Fire's range greatly. | |||
